1) German Chancellor Angela Merkel arrives in India for her three-day visit
German Chancellor Angela Merkel arrived in New Delhi on Sunday evening for the third Inter-Governmental Consultations (IGC) between India and Germany. Read the full report here.
2) Amit Shah said that Bihar will see a 'tsunami of development' under BJP rule
Addressing a rally in Katihar in Bihar's Seemanchal region, Amit Shah said "Bihar will see a tsunami of development" if NDA comes to power in the state.

3) Won't allow Muslims at Garba to prevent 'love jihad', says right-wing group in Gujarat
The organisation will ensure that any person entering the Garba pandal has a tilak on his forehead, and 'Gaumutra' (cow-urine) will be sprayed on him. Read the full story here.
4) Counting of municipal election votes in West Bengal postponed indefinitely following reports of violence
The West Bengal State Election Commission on Sunday postponed counting of votes in the election to Bidhannagar and Asansol municipal corporations following allegations of large-scale violence, even as opposition parties demanded fresh elections. Read full story here.
